Udostępnij za pośrednictwem


RIGHT

Dotyczy:kolumna obliczeniowatabela obliczeniowaMeasureobliczenia wizualne

RIGHT zwraca znak lastor znaków w ciągu tekstowym na podstawie określonej liczby znaków.

Składnia

RIGHT(<text>, <num_chars>)

Parametry

Termin Definicja
text Ciąg tekstowy, który contains znaki, które chcesz wyodrębnić, or odwołanie do kolumny, która contains tekst.
num_chars (opcjonalnie) Liczba znaków, które mają zostać wyodrębnione RIGHT; zostanie pominięty, 1. Możesz również użyć odwołania do kolumny, która contains liczby.

If odwołanie do kolumny not zawiera tekst, jest niejawnie rzutowy jako tekst.

Zwracanie value

Ciąg tekstowy zawierający określone right-most znaków.

Uwagi

  • RIGHT zawsze liczy każdy znak, niezależnie od tego, czy jednobajtowe or dwubajtowe, niezależnie od tego, jakie jest ustawienie języka domyślnego.

  • Ta funkcja jest not obsługiwana do użycia w trybie DirectQuery w przypadku użycia w kolumnach obliczeniowych or reguł zabezpieczeń na poziomie wiersza.

Przykład: zwracanie Fixed liczby znaków

Poniższa formuła zwraca last dwie cyfry kodu product w tabeli New Products.

= RIGHT('New Products'[ProductCode],2)

Przykład: używanie odwołania do kolumny w celu określenia Count znaków

Poniższa formuła zwraca zmienną liczbę cyfr z kodu product w tabeli New Products w zależności od liczby w kolumnie MyCount. If w kolumnie MyCount nie ma value, orvalue jest blank, RIGHT zwraca również blank.

= RIGHT('New Products'[ProductCode],[MyCount])

funkcje tekstoweLEFTMID